Did Not Provide As Advertised and Promised!. We choose Enterprise as they would pick us up at Amtrak and let us leave the card at the airport. Their website had a Dodge Magnum for 107 dollars for a 2 day weekend. $27 higher than a Charger here in Oregon. But we called their operator who said the car would be a Charger at 107 and confirmed they served the airport and were open weekends. All they had when we arrive was a P T Cruiser. It cost us the same. They said it is the same type of car as a Magnum (which they don't have) and a Charger (which was out). They do not have a drop box at the airport. We would have to return the car and call a cab at 4:30 am Sunday. And they are not open weekends at all. We returned the little Cruiser and called a cab at 4:33 am. I choose U S Cab and we recalled them three times always being told they are just around the corner. There is not adequate light for 63 YEAR OLD thath time of night. There is no bench to sit on. At 5:33 an intercept said that cell phone was no longer in operation. We did get the number (in the dark) for Yellow Cab that showed in 3 minutes and just barely got us to the airport in time for an early departure to San Francisco. I looked online and called their phone system and they still say they serve the airport, have a drop box there, and are open weekends. And guess what, a P T Cruiser IS CHEAPER THAN A CHARGER.

I knew Enterprise costs more. I had great service here in Oregon. No one in Bakersfield, on the reservation phone system would help. The owner of that agency uis Sacremento Enterprise which is reACHABLE AT THE FRESNO location. It is realkly hidden well. No one has called us back. I no longer trust Enterprise. I have had better luck at the discount agencies.
